Full Job Description
Position Summary

The Senior Manager, HR Excellence & Operations is responsible for leading the execution, administration, and continuous improvement of talent and HR processes across a portfolio of business units. This role serves as a key partner to HR and business leaders by driving operational excellence in leadership development, talent management, integrations, training deployment, talent mobility, and HR systems optimization.

This position will focus on building scalable processes, ensuring consistent execution across business units, ensuring data quality to drive decision-making, and identifying opportunities to improve efficiency and effectiveness across the employee lifecycle.

The ideal candidate is highly organized, process-oriented, data-driven, and passionate about creating sustainable HR solutions that improve business and talent outcomes.

Key Responsibilities

Talent & Leadership Development Programs
  • Lead the execution and administration of the Platform Talent Development Program
  • Coordinate participant selection, assessments, communications, development activities, progress reviews, and reporting.
  • Track program effectiveness and recommend improvements to increase participant engagement and business impact.
  • Partner with HR and business leaders to ensure successful execution of talent development initiatives.

Talent Management & Internal Mobility
  • Support talent review and succession planning processes across operating companies.
  • Coordinate talent-exporting and internal mobility efforts to facilitate development opportunities and strengthen organizational capability.
  • Maintain visibility of talent pipelines and development plans.
  • Provide reporting and insights related to talent movement, succession readiness, and bench strength.

M&A
  • Lead the execution of HR integration activities associated with acquisitions and organizational transitions.
  • Coordinate onboarding of acquired organizations into platform talent processes, systems, and leadership programs.
  • Develop and maintain integration playbooks, templates, and tracking mechanisms.
  • Monitor integration progress and identify opportunities for process improvement and standardization.

IDEX Operating Model Training Deployment
  • Coordinate deployment and administration of IDEX Operating Model training across the platform.
  • Manage training schedules, enrollment, participation tracking, communications, and reporting.
  • Partner with leaders to drive completion and reinforce adoption of operating model principles.
  • Continuously improve training processes, materials, and participant experiences.


HR Process Excellence & Continuous Improvement
  • Lead continuous improvement initiatives focused on increasing efficiency, effectiveness, and consistency across HR processes.
  • Apply LEAN methodologies to streamline and standardize processes, including:
    • Frontline recruiting
    • New hire onboarding
    • Leadership development
    • Succession planning activities
  • Develop and maintain standard operating procedures, process maps, templates, and governance documentation.
  • Establish metrics and dashboards to monitor process effectiveness and identify improvement opportunities.

Workday Data Quality & Optimization
  • Serve as the platform lead for talent-related Workday data quality initiatives.
  • Conduct audits and monitor compliance with data governance standards.
  • Drive process discipline and system utilization to improve accuracy, consistency, and reporting reliability.
  • Partner with HR teams to identify and implement Workday process improvements.
  • Support reporting and analytics necessary to monitor talent processes and program effectiveness.

About IDEX Corp

IDEX Corporation is a manufacturer of engineered products for fluidics, optics, and precision dispensing applications. The company's products are used in a variety of industries, including life sciences, industrial, and semiconductor. IDEX operates in three business segments: Fluid & Metering Technologies, Health & Science Technologies, and Fire & Safety/Diversified Products. The company was founded in 1987 and is headquartered in San Jose, California.
